Titanium does not conduct heat as effectively as other metals so place cutting oil to prevent overheating. Heat can easily degrade a regular drill bit so use stronger drill bit types.

Drill bits should be sharp and long enough to allow for the free flow of metal shards or chips. A dull drill impedes the passage of chips along the flutes, resulting in poor drilling results.

Because of the unique characteristics of titanium, drilling it can be challenging. In addition, the high temperature generated during drilling and the cutting edge’s poor heat distribution makes drilling titanium alloys even more difficult.

You can drill titanium even with a regular HSS metal drill bit. However, drilling titanium needs extensive planning and access to the necessary equipment. Carbide tipped drill bits are recommended because they are stronger than titanium.

Carbide metal drilling bits are suited for nonferrous metal drilling. They outlive cobalt drills by a factor of ten or twenty and can easily drill through titanium. Carbide drill bits are the best bits for drilling titanium.

So when drilling titanium it’s better to use tougher drill bits like carbide because of the toughness of titanium compared to steel.

Drilling titanium can be more challenging than drilling other metals, due to its innate toughness. However, with the right technique, speed, and drill bit type, you can successfully drill a hole in titanium. It is quite similar to drilling stainless steel since you need moderate speed and pressure for both materials.

Carbide drill bits are the best for titanium, but in case they are not available, you can also use a titanium coated or cobalt drill bit.
